About the role
Role Overview
Compliance Analyst (Accident & Health, with some Property & Casualty) working with the Compliance Department to ensure product, marketing, and policy fulfillment activities meet regulatory and company requirements.
What You Will Do
- Prepare, develop, and issue policy contracts, amendments, and related forms for complex product structures in line with company policy and state regulations.
- Document and maintain policy issuance processes and state availability guidelines for assigned products.
- Support policy automation efforts, including user acceptance testing (UAT) of forms and benefit features.
- Maintain the forms library and publish updates for internal and external use.
- Manage fulfillment status, perform regular reporting, and complete fulfillment requests accurately and on time.
- Respond to customer requests and leverage technology to streamline fulfillment.
- Collaborate with Underwriting, Claims, Legal, and Actuarial teams.
Reporting & Oversight
- Works under the direction of the Compliance Manager.
Notes / Details
- The Compliance Department is responsible for submitting product filings (forms/rates/rules) to state departments of insurance and reviewing marketing materials for adherence to unfair trade practices and advertising guidelines.
- The role involves maintaining regulatory compliance and ensuring policies/certificates are properly issued.
